About #A6ACAF Color Code

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 200°, a saturation of 5%, and a lightness of 67%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 200°, a saturation of 5%, and a value of 69%.

  • HEX: #A6ACAF
  • RGB: rgb(166, 172, 175)
  • HSL: hsl(200, 5%, 67%)
  • HSV: hsv(200, 5%, 69%)
  • CMYK: 5.00% cyan, 2.00% magenta, 0.00% yellow, 31.00% black
  • XYZ: 38.65, 40.66, 35.15
  • Yxy: 40.66, 0.3377, 0.3552
  • Hunter Lab: 69.94, -1.76, -2.32
  • CIE-Lab: 69.94, -1.76, -2.32

In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 38.65, Y: 40.66, Z: 35.15.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 40.66, x: 0.3377, and y: 0.3552.

In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 69.94, a: -1.76, and b: -2.32.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 69.94, a: -1.76, and b: -2.32.
